reproductive isolation. The Closterium peracerosum-strigosum-littorale complex is a unicellular alga, and it is composed of several reproductively isolated mating groups of heterothallic strains. However, only mating groups IIA, IIB, and IE can be maintained. I performed field studies to obtained reproductively isolated Closterium peracerosum-strigosum-littorale complexes. Then, I established a new mating group, G. I studied the phylogenetic relationship by using DNA sequences of 1506 group I introns of these mating group. According to the alignment, significant phylogenetic relationships were observed among mating groups IE and G, while mating groups IIA and IIB were distant from groups IE and G. Mating group IE was completely sexually isolated from mating group G. However, partial communication of the sex pheromone existed. Finally, I studied a sex pheromone and sexual isolation by comparing RNA-seq data of mating group G with those of mating group IE
